Up Goodwood Festival of Speed 2012 - Saturday 30 June 2012 Prev Next Slideshow

 Previous image  Next image  Index page
_MMP5430
_MMP5431
_MMP5432
_MMP5434
_MMP5435
  _MMP5436.jpg  
_MMP5440
_MMP5443
_MMP5446
_MMP5448
_MMP5449

MMP5436 Download
Total images: 600 | Help